Mimi Zohar <zohar@linux.vnet.ibm.com> wrote:

> As the signature would be stored as an extended attribute, we wouldn't
> need to pass it. Unfortunately not all filesystems have xattr support,
> nor do all of the package installation mechanims. The benefit of
> storing the signature as an extended attribute, however, is that there
> is a consistent mechanism for verifying file data integrity for all
> files, not only ELF.

We also want to be able to do module signature verification with CONFIG_IMA=n.
